Linux жүйесіндегі MySQL-дегі кесте жолдар мен бағандарға реттелген ақпаратты қамтитын құрылымдық деректер жиыны болып табылады. Әрбір бағанның мәтіндік деректер үшін VARCHAR немесе бүтін деректер үшін INT сияқты кесте жасалғанда анықталған өзіндік деректер түрі болады. Неліктен кестені тазалау керек екенін алдыңғы мақалада түсіндірдік. Бұл нұсқаулықта біз жеке әдіске, атап айтқанда, DELETE операторын қолдануға тоқталамыз.
MySQL-де кестеден жолдарды жою үшін белгілі бір шарт негізінде жазбаларды жоюға мүмкіндік беретін DELETE операторын пайдалануға болады.
Джон қолданушысы бар MyGuests кестесі бар делік. Джон аты бар және id
1-ге тең жазбаны жою үшін аты бағанында WHERE
шарты бар DELETE
операторын орындау керек:
DELETE FROM MyGuests WHERE firstname = 'John';
DELETE операторын кестедегі барлық жазбаларды жою үшін де пайдалануға болады.
Барлық жазбаларды жою үшін DELETE операторын шартсыз орындау керек:
DELETE FROM MyGuests;
Осылайша MySQL кестесін тазалауға болады.
Бұл нұсқаулық сізге пайдалы деп үміттенеміз.